Curiosità sulla canzone The Four Winds and the Seven Seas di Vic Damone

Quando è stata rilasciata la canzone “The Four Winds and the Seven Seas” di Vic Damone?
La canzone The Four Winds and the Seven Seas è stata rilasciata nel 1962, nell’album “Tenderly”.
Chi ha composto la canzone “The Four Winds and the Seven Seas” di di Vic Damone?
La canzone “The Four Winds and the Seven Seas” di di Vic Damone è stata composta da DON RODNEY, HAL DAVID.
